Armando Santos (above)


It's been a good September for the 'Shiners thus far. The team racked up 14 wins in September with 9 losses.
That may not be great to others, but it's an improvement from last month's record nonetheless (10 wins, 15 losses in August).

After announcing his retirement last week, Sirius Black has been hitting the ball well. He has 28 hits in 84 at bats (.333, .915 OPS), 5 home runs with 21 RBIs in the month of September.
Also in the news, Mack Milholm has been terrific after signing his extension with Greeneville last week. He won 2 games out of 6 GS, with an ERA of 3.98 in 43 innings pitched.

Last but not the least, Armando Santos finally got his 2000th hit against Louisville. And oh by the way, to reach the milestone, Santos went 4-4, 3 RBIs, including a double, and two home runs.
It can't get any better than that.

"It's good to finally get it. The closer you get to 2000, the harder it is to get there. Now the pressure is off and I can go back to just playing ball." Santos told reporters.

As far as career numbers Santos has compiled a .314 batting average and collected 2001 hits, 230 home runs and 914 RBIs.

Looks like the 'Shiners are in the verge of finishing the season strong.

There's a lot things to look forward to next season, including rumors about the team getting a new logo/uniform for next season.
